React Native 是一个由 Facebook 开发的开源框架,允许开发者使用 JavaScript 编写跨平台移动应用。它结合了原生应用的性能和 Web 技术的灵活性,成为许多开发者的首选。
与传统的原生开发相比,React Native 能够同时支持 iOS 和 Android 平台,大幅减少了开发时间和成本。开发者只需编写一次代码,即可在多个平台上运行,提高了效率。
AI绘图结果,仅供参考
React Native 的组件化设计使得代码更易维护和复用。开发者可以利用丰富的第三方库和社区支持,快速实现复杂功能,而无需从头开始构建所有内容。
热重载功能是 React Native 的一大亮点,它允许开发者在不重新启动应用的情况下实时查看代码更改的效果,提升了开发体验和调试效率。
尽管 React Native 在性能上接近原生应用,但在某些复杂场景下仍可能需要结合原生模块来优化表现。然而,对于大多数应用场景而言,React Native 已经足够强大且稳定。
总体来看,React Native 为跨平台移动开发提供了一个高效、灵活且易于学习的解决方案,适合希望快速构建高质量应用的团队和个人。